Solo travel beckons with the promise of self-discovery and adventure. Journeying solo is a liberating experience, a chance to explore the world on your own terms. However, it comes with some risks that may not apply when exploring with a group. A touch of prudence helps to ensure a smooth, enriching experience. Let's explore how to balance the thrill of solo travel with smart, mindful practices.
1. Planning with a Dash of Spontaneity
Know the Basics: Do some research on your destination's culture and general safety tips. A little knowledge goes a long way.
Book Your First Night: Having your initial accommodation sorted gives you a comfortable landing spot.
Leave Room for the Unexpected: Some of the best travel moments are unplanned. Be open to detours and local recommendations.
2. Smart Habits, Not Paranoia
Keep Someone Informed: Let a friend or family member know your itinerary. You don't need to overshare, just give them a rough idea.
Be Aware, Not Alarmed: Pay attention to your surroundings, especially in crowded areas. Trust your gut; if something feels off, it probably is.
Secure Your Essentials: Keep your valuables close and consider a money belt or secure pouch.
3. Connecting and Enjoying the Moment
Stay Connected: A local SIM card or portable Wi-Fi helps you navigate and stay in touch.
Join a Tour or Activity: It's a great way to meet people and learn about the local culture.
Chat with Locals: A friendly conversation can lead to unexpected discoveries.
Savor the "Me Time": Enjoy the solitude. Read a book, explore a museum at your own pace, or simply enjoy a quiet meal.
4. Practical Tips for Smooth Travels
Pack Light: A lighter bag means more freedom and less to worry about.
Have Digital & Physical Copies: Keep copies of your important documents in case of loss or theft.
Learn a Few Phrases: Knowing basic greetings and phrases like "thank you" goes a long way.
Use Reputable Transportation: Opt for licensed taxis or ride-sharing services.
5. Responsible Independence
Stay Aware: Especially at night, or in unfamiliar areas.
Don't Overshare: Be mindful of how much information you give to strangers.
Enjoy Yourself: Solo travel is an amazing experience, so make the most of it.
